Biological Background: hnRNP A1 Function and Localization

  • Heterogeneous nuclear ribonucleoprotein A1 (hnRNP A1), also known as helix-destabilizing protein or single-strand RNA-binding protein, is an RNA-binding protein encoded by the HNRNPA1 gene (Gene ID: 3178).
  • Involved in packaging pre-mRNA into hnRNP particles, transporting poly(A) mRNA from nucleus to cytoplasm, and modulating splice site selection. Related references: PMID:17371836
  • Plays a role in splicing of pyruvate kinase PKM by repressing sequences flanking PKM exon 9, inhibiting exon 9 inclusion, leading to exon 10 inclusion and production of the PKM M2 isoform. Related references: PMID:20010808
  • Binds to the IRES and inhibits translation of apoptosis protease activating factor APAF1. Related references: PMID:31498791
  • May bind to specific miRNA hairpins. Related references: PMID:28431233
  • Localizes to both nucleus and cytoplasm, participating in nucleocytoplasmic shuttling of mRNA.
  • Undergoes acetylation, methylation, phosphorylation, and ubiquitin conjugation; disease variants are associated with amyotrophic lateral sclerosis (ALS19, ALS20) and neurodegeneration.
  • May play a role in HCV RNA replication; cleavage by Enterovirus 71 protease 3C leads to increased APAF1 translation and apoptosis.

Experimental Guidance and Technical Tips

  • The immunogen corresponds to the N-terminal region (aa 1‑140) of human hnRNP A1; the antibody may recognize full-length and N-terminal fragments. KO validation supports specificity in western blotting.
  • For western blotting, use whole-cell or tissue lysates from human, mouse, or rat. Include appropriate controls and validate detection of the ~39 kDa band.
  • For immunofluorescence/ICC, expect nuclear and cytoplasmic staining. Optimize fixation and permeabilization conditions for the relevant cell line.
  • For ELISA, test against recombinant hnRNP A1 protein or cell lysates; confirm linearity and detection limit in the experimental system.
  • Consider cross-reactivity with other species if needed, and validate by sequence homology.
